Synopsis As Introduced
Creates the Local Government Residential Inspection Limitation Act. Provides that, except for a fire, medical, or police emergency or as otherwise permitted by specified provisions of the Fire Investigation Act, a unit of local government may not conduct a physical inspection of residential property without the voluntary consent of the owner or occupant of the property, a lawful warrant, or court order. Limits home rule powers.
